About Finkle Green

Finkle Green rests in the gentle curve of Essex, a quiet acknowledgement of the land. It lies 6.1 km south-south-east of Haverhill (from Haverhill: bearing 151°T, OS grid TL 702 402), and is situated south-south-west of Birdbrook village.
